Accessing MLB on ilmzhESPN
First things first, how do you actually get your MLB fix on ESPN? Well, the good news is, it's pretty easy! ilmzhESPN provides extensive coverage across multiple platforms, so you can catch the action wherever you are. One of the primary ways to watch MLB games is through your cable or satellite TV subscription. ESPN is a major sports network, so it's likely included in your package. Just tune in to the appropriate ESPN channel to watch live games, highlights, and studio shows. Also, ESPN has streaming services. The popular ESPN+ service offers a wide variety of MLB content, including live games, replays, and on-demand programming. You can subscribe to ESPN+ directly through the ESPN website or app, or bundle it with other streaming services. Don't forget that ESPN also has a fantastic website and app, where you can find scores, stats, news, and video highlights. The ESPN app, available for both iOS and Android devices, allows you to watch live games, catch up on the latest news, and stay updated on scores and standings. The ESPN website and app are great resources for staying informed about MLB. Keep in mind that some content might be exclusive to specific platforms or require a subscription. One of the top names in MLB broadcasting at ESPN is Karl Ravech. Ravech, a respected play-by-play announcer, is known for his calm, professional demeanor and extensive knowledge of the sport. He is a primary voice for ESPN's Sunday Night Baseball telecasts. Joining him in the booth is the esteemed analyst, David Cone. Cone, a former MLB pitcher, brings an invaluable insider's perspective, providing sharp analysis and tactical insights. Another familiar voice is Jon Sciambi, another respected play-by-play announcer for the network. Sciambi, known for his enthusiastic style, has become a prominent figure in ESPN's MLB coverage. The team is further bolstered by veteran analyst, Jessica Mendoza. Mendoza, a former softball player, brings a unique perspective to the broadcast.
